Artistic gymnast Johann König was selected for the 1960 Rome Olympics. There, he placed 90th in the individual all-around and 16th with the Austrian team. Domestically, he represented Turnerschaft Wolfurt and won 24 national titles. He represented Austria at one World and five European Championships.
